In the present paper, it is suggested that the observation of cavities near Ganymede can be explained by a model which postulates that Ganymede continuously creates a cavity that is stretched out into a sheet along X by rotation and is spatially distorted by a spectrum of Alfven waves with perturbations along Y and with wavelengths comparable to the size of the field lines passing through Ganymede. Possible causes of the cavities are examined.
